Generates a self-employed individual's four IRS estimated-tax payment amounts and due dates from their income, deductions, and prior-year return figures, producing a payment-schedule PDF plus a fully-formula XLSX 1040-ES-style worksheet. Use when a freelancer, sole proprietor, or 1099 contractor needs to calculate or refresh quarterly estimated tax payments, or check them against safe-harbor rules to avoid underpayment penalties.

Sample input
I'm a freelance graphic designer. I need to figure out my quarterly estimated tax payments for 2025. I'm single, prior-year total tax was around $18,500. This year I'm projecting $95,000 in gross revenue and $12,000 in business expenses. Can you build me the payment schedule?
